Renewed hope, a sense of peace / calmness, clarification, and practical ideas to move forward
This retreat exceeded my expectations. It is hard to put into words the healing that I have received from being in Gozo around such a great group of genuine kind hearted, authentic, caring, empathetic, sensitive, non judgemental, thoughtful humans for a week, both the retreat leaders and all the other participants.
At other retreats I have experienced more of an undercurrent of healing whereas with Samudra it seemed more like a holiday in the sun on an island with friends, where people were also there to laugh, have fun and enjoy themselves in the process of deeply healing.
I experienced a very supportive, uplifting, emotionally safe environment where everyone could connect authentically, share without judgement or feel accepted and supported if they did not feel comfortable sharing / participating at a particular time. One housemate in particular went out of her way to make me feel like an accepted member of the group (along with proactively being considerate reaching out checking regarding having other retreat guests over in the shared spaces of the house).
Two of the retreat leaders Kevin, and Iris sat talking to me for hours outside of the scheduled individual contact time. Iris sitting with me chatting like you might to a friend late into the night after I was feeling particularly overwhelmed felt very supportive and meant a lot to me, along with her practical advice about my living situation and sharing her own past experiences. Iris’s expertise and intuition with massage are nothing like I have experienced before in any massage. Kevin’s insights, questions to consider, practical advice, and encouragement have been very supportive including checking in after the retreat.
Mila’s Yoga philosophy was thought provoking and her breathwork techniques session showed us there are many different types even if one type has not worked for you in the past. Luca’s Tarot/chat and practical advice around living situations and her background was very helpful, and she even wrote some extra notes for me to research later. Beatrice’s kind loving energy, presence and positivity is contagious. Nikos the chef is extremely dedicated, enthusiastic, and clearly has a deep passion for his work, providing such a variety of healthy, nutritious and tasty meals.
This week in Gozo with Samudra has meant so much to me, I have received renewed hope, a sense of peace / calmness in my body, clarification, and practical ideas to move forward and make changes in my life, along with offers of further support from Kevin and Iris, and just a great deal of healing from realising for the first time that there are spaces with positive minded, caring, deeply feeling, sensitive, empathetic, authentic, non judgemental people out there.
